The Evolving Landscape of AI Research and Development
The field of AI is in constant flux, with new breakthroughs emerging regularly. Current research focuses on several key areas:
- Generative AI: Models like OpenAI‘s GPT series continue to advance, becoming increasingly adept at generating realistic text, images, and even code. The focus is now on improving their control and reducing biases.
- Explainable AI (XAI): As AI systems become more complex, understanding how they arrive at decisions is crucial. XAI aims to make AI models more transparent and interpretable.
- Reinforcement Learning: This area focuses on training AI agents to make decisions in complex environments. Advances in reinforcement learning are driving progress in robotics, autonomous vehicles, and game playing.
- Edge AI: Bringing AI processing closer to the data source, rather than relying on centralized cloud servers, is enabling faster response times and improved privacy. This is particularly relevant for applications like IoT devices and autonomous systems.

The Rise of AI-Powered Automation
Automation is one of the most significant impacts of AI. While concerns about job displacement are valid, AI-powered automation also creates new opportunities.
- Robotic Process Automation (RPA): RPA uses software robots to automate repetitive tasks, freeing up human employees to focus on more strategic work. Companies like UiPath are leaders in this field.
- Intelligent Automation: This goes beyond RPA by incorporating AI capabilities such as machine learning and natural language processing to automate more complex tasks.
- Autonomous Systems: Self-driving cars, drones, and robots are becoming increasingly capable, automating tasks in transportation, logistics, and other industries.

Ethical Considerations and Responsible AI Development
As AI becomes more powerful, ethical considerations become increasingly important.
- Bias and Fairness: AI models can perpetuate and amplify existing biases in the data they are trained on. It’s crucial to develop AI systems that are fair and unbiased.
- Privacy and Security: AI systems often require access to large amounts of data, raising concerns about privacy and security. Robust data protection measures are essential.
- Transparency and Accountability: It’s important to understand how AI systems make decisions and to hold them accountable for their actions.
- Job Displacement: Automation driven by AI can lead to job losses in some sectors. It’s important to provide retraining and support for workers who are displaced.
